HB 802 Virginia Pump Toll; established.

Introduced by: Joe T. May | all patrons    ...    notes | add to my profiles

S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:

Transportation funding and administration; Virginia Pump Toll ("FareShare").  Imposes the Virginia Pump Toll ("FareShare"), in the amount of (i) $0.50 on each use of a retail motor fuels pump and an additional $0.50 when purchasing 35 or more gallons; (ii) $1.00 on each 12-gallon sale of gasoline (other than for resale) from a transport truck or tank wagon and on each 60-gallon sale of diesel fuel (other than for resale) from a transport truck or tank wagon; (iii) an amount to be determined by the Commissioner of the Department of Motor Vehicles on the bulk purchase of clean fuel other than electricity at a rate equivalent to $1.00 times the volume of clean fuel required to fill the average size fuel tank to three quarters full; and (iv) $0.50 on each sale of clean fuel at an electric vehicle charging service facility. Revenue from the FareShare shall be used for highway maintenance and operation in the highway construction district in which the motor fuel is sold. The amount of the FareShare increases by 10 percent every five years. The bill has a delayed effective date of January 1, 2013.
